About the Role
The Visual Merchandise Manager is responsible for executing corporate visual merchandising strategies, achieving business goals, and fostering an inclusive and collaborative work environment that drives results and delivers amazing guest experiences. The VMM may oversee multiple store locations and is accountable for visual presentation, operational excellence, employee engagement, and ensuring that every guest interaction is memorable.
Merchandising & Visual Responsibilities
- Engage guests with enthusiasm, professionalism, and in-depth product knowledge
- Organize and conduct store meetings with effective communication and clear action steps
- Implement all corporate visual merchandising directives and strategies
- Lead assortment walkthroughs, analyze sales data, and follow up with actions to optimize store assortments
- Ensure proper signage and presentation of all displays, fixtures, and collections
- Maintain showroom and warehouse cleanliness and organization
- Coordinate facility maintenance, upgrades, and repairs to enhance the guest experience

Physical & Schedule Expectations
- May occasionally perform hands-on duties such as unloading trailers or merchandising as needed
- Must be able to lift, lower, push, or pull furniture over 100 lbs and stand for extended periods
- Full-time: Minimum 40 hours per week
- Additional hours during market events, holidays, peak seasons, and for vacation coverage
- 25–50% travel within the region to support multiple store locations
Education & Experience Requirements
- BA or BS in retail management, visual merchandising, graphic design, interior design, marketing, or related field (or equivalent experience)
- Minimum 5 years of experience in retail visual merchandising or design (furniture retail preferred)
- 3-5 years of supervisory experience
